KISSology: Volume One 1974-1977 follows the meteoric rise of KISS from the New York glam rock bar scene of the early 1970s to their role as international rock gods, filling the world's largest arenas as the undisputed hottest band in the land in 1977. A KISS fan's dream come true, "KISSology: Volume One 1974-1977", contains hours of seldom seen high points of KISStory including significant never-before-available surprise material found in the bands personal video vaults. In addition to four full concerts from the peak of the band's rise, the DVD set also features notorious television interviews, early KISS music videos and unreleased tracks. Included in the lavish "KISSology: Volume One 1974-1977" package are incredible eyewitness liner notes penned by the members of KISS themselves.
